Q: Is 138,553,658 a Prime Number?
A: No, 138,553,658 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 138553658 can be evenly divided by 1 2 107 214 409 818 1,583 3,166 43,763 87,526 169,381 338,762 647,447 1,294,894 69,276,829 and 138,553,658, with no remainder.
Since 138,553,658 cannot be divided by just 1 and 138,553,658, it is not a prime number.
